>>   I got a question in regards to using the software OpenOffice.org if i was 
>> to use it for myself its free am i correct here?
>>   Suppose if i wanted to use it for my business can i use it or is there a 
>> different license scheme for commercial use.
>>   If so Where can i find details in regards to that or will you be able to 
>> provide me with some.
>>     
>
> It's free, no matter how you use it.  However, for business use, you may
> want to consider StarOffice, which is the pay version of OO and includes
> a few more features and some support.
